    The little-known mortgage trick that might prevent 1000’s

    EditorialBy EditorialJune 15, 2022Updated:June 15, 2022 Investing No Comments5 Mins Read
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

    Homeowners may save 1000’s of kilos through the use of a little-known mortgage trick.

    And the timing couldn’t be higher as debtors brace for the Bank of England to hike rates of interest to a 13-year excessive tomorrow.

    Around 1.5 million fixed-rate residence loans are set to run out this yr, in response to banking commerce physique UK Finance.

    With rates of interest rising, debtors face a hefty bounce of their month-to-month repayments. Yet there’s a solution to mitigate this further expense – you simply must act rapidly.

    Many debtors don’t realise that lenders typically assist you to lock into a brand new charge as much as six months earlier than your present deal ends. 

    They as a substitute wait till their current mortgage has run its course earlier than signing as much as a brand new supply.

    But with prime charges now disappearing nearly each day and rates of interest set to soar, this could possibly be a expensive mistake.

    In reality, Money Mail figures present that reserving a brand new charge early may save the common house owner practically £500 a yr — greater than £2,000 over the course of a typical five-year mounted deal.

    A hard and fast deal permits debtors to lock of their charge for a interval of two, three, 5 and even ten years. When it ends, they have to choose a brand new deal to keep away from paying their lender’s ‘standard variable rate’, which is normally vastly dearer.

    If you turn earlier than the tip of your time period it normally triggers a hefty penalty often known as an early compensation cost. 

    But most lenders supply a loophole that permits debtors to use for a brand new deal as much as six months earlier than their time period expires — which may show invaluable within the present market.

    David Hollingworth, of dealer London & Country, says: ‘With rates rising, you could bag a rate that simply won’t be obtainable in a single month’s time, not to mention six.’

    The Bank of England has now hiked the bottom charge 4 occasions since December, from a document low of 0.1 per cent to 1 per cent final month.

    Tomorrow may deliver recent ache with charges anticipated to leap to 1.25 per cent, presumably larger.

    Experts additionally predict rates of interest may hit 2 per cent earlier than the tip of the yr because the Bank battles to maintain a lid on spiralling inflation.

    As a end result, low cost mortgage offers are quick disappearing. All sub-1 per cent offers have vanished since final yr.

    The common two-year fixed-rate deal has now breached 3 per cent for the primary time in over seven years, in response to information analysts Moneyfacts. 

    And a typical five-year mortgage nudged up by 0.16 proportion factors in only one month from April to May.

    Analysis by Money Mail reveals the common family may save £475 in a single yr alone by agreeing a brand new mortgage deal upfront — a £2,375 saving over 5 years. This relies on a typical excellent residence mortgage of £161,774.

    If the common five-year mounted charge rises by an additional 0.5 proportion factors by the tip of 2022, debtors would pay 3.67 per cent in contrast with 3.17 per cent now. 

    With the mortgage dimension above, this could value owners on a five-year deal an additional £39.59 a month — or £475 a yr.

    While many owners might desire to repair charges for longer phrases, consultants are cautious of recommending ten-year mounted offers.

    Jonathan Harris, managing director of dealer Forensic Property Finance, says: ‘There’s been elevated curiosity in ten-year fixes as a result of they’re so competitively priced. But as soon as folks realise the early compensation fees concerned, they typically change their thoughts.’

    Anyone who has suffered monetary setbacks might discover it simpler to use for a product switch with their current lender. 

    These are normally obtainable as much as three months earlier than your deal ends and could be faster to rearrange because the financial institution already is aware of your particulars.

    Mr Harris says: ‘While you can arrange a product transfer without proof of income, you can’t remortgage with out it — which is why the previous works higher for some.’

    For some debtors, who’re maybe trying to transfer home quickly, a versatile, variable-rate deal should still work out finest as there are not any early-exit charges.

    Rosie Fish, of on-line mortgage firm Habito, says: ‘If you have six months or less left on your current deal, now is the time to get ahead of any further rate rises. 

    The cheapest deals on the market are being withdrawn at short notice, so make sure your documents are in order to help avoid delays when it’s time to submit your utility.’

    A mortgage dealer may help you discover the best deal on the proper time, in addition to entry provides not obtainable to owners direct.

    London & Country, Habito, and Trussle are all fee-free. Website unbiased.co.uk may also join you with brokers in your space.
